      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Hi all,&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;I'm trying to publish some maps to the server 10.1.&amp;nbsp; When they are "analyzed" they show that the data is not registered with the server.&amp;nbsp; I then go to the folder and register the data.&amp;nbsp; It says the data is registered, however, when it's "re-analyzed" it gives the same error.&amp;nbsp; If I go to each sub folder in the catalog tree and register them, then it's ok.&amp;nbsp; In the documentation it says when you register a folder, all sub folders are registered too.&amp;nbsp; This doesn't seem to be working.&amp;nbsp; Any ideas?&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;On a similar note: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Also, when I try to register any folders in the data stores which are accessed via a share I keep getting "Invalid folder location. Unable to access this location".&amp;nbsp; I have access to all the data, and all my map documents open properly with all the data.&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Help, thanx Eddie&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Eddie: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Are you publishing the maps to server 10.1 on the same machine where server is installed?&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;If so, is your data stored in an Oracle SDE database?&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;This is my current setup and I had to install both 32 and 64 bit Oracle Client software in order to register the data stores correctly and not have the SDE data automatically copied to the ArcGIS Server server.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;I don't know if this will help, but at least you can rule it out if it does not apply.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
